> 5.2 Changing a Preferred Address and Multihoming Support
> 
>    From MOBIKE's point of view multihoming support is integrated by
>    supporting a peer address set rather than a single address and
>    protocol mechanisms to change to use a new preferred IP address.
>    From a protocol point of view each peer needs to learn the 
> preferred
>    address and the peer address set somehow, implicitly or explicitly.
>

> Original text:
> 
> MOBIKE does not include
>    load balancing, i.e., only one IP address is set to a preferred
>    address at a time and changing the preferred address typically
>    requires some MOBIKE signaling.
> 
> Another option is to only communicate one address towards the other
>    peer and both peers only use that address when communicating.  If
>    this preferred address cannot be used anymore then an 
> address update
>    is sent to the other peer changing the primary address.
>
